capote vs topcoat

capote

noun
  • A long coat or cloak with a hood. 

  • A close-fitting woman's bonnet. 

  • A coat made from a blanket, worn by 19th-century Canadian woodsmen. 

topcoat

noun
  • A light overcoat. 

  • A layer of paint or varnish etc. applied after the undercoat. 

verb
  • To apply a topcoat to.
